Output 043b575397314ee013d0dd453dda94473736e15f1c435f8578b8074f01f50253:15

value
5000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0deb4350e4deffff19f56c733473e99b25a3b345 OP_EQUALVERIFY OP_CHECKSIG
address
12GbcrKZycFqrEYaWPth1Lt22L3hhxPM91
transaction
043b575397314ee013d0dd453dda94473736e15f1c435f8578b8074f01f50253
spent
true